Hi everyone,
My husband and I are bring our almost 3 year old b/g twins to Disney in September(the first time we are going as a family!!!!!). We are staying at the Contemporary for 5d/4nights. We are staying outside Disney at the Holiday Sunspree for 5d/4nights as well, which is only going to cost us $49(have to go see a timeshare). I know this might insane, but I'm thinking of cancelling the Sunspree (since now I'm reading that the hotel is not nice) and staying an extra 3-4 nights at the Contemporary (which will cost a lot more). I just don't know how I am going to cope with going from staying inside Disney on the monorail and then going to a Holiday Inn after that. Will I be able to handle the drastic change???? I'm getting so obsessed with Disney that anything else just doesn't feel right. What do you think? Linda
 
After reading some of the reviews I also would be very leary about staying there. If you can afford it I'd stay on site. If the contemporary is too much Maybe stay somewhere else for those few days...or even flip your vacation stay at a value or a moderate first then spend the last few nights at the contemporary...
 
Can you do the Sun Spree first? I totally agree. It would be hard to go from a monorail resort to off-property.
